Cozy up with a comforting bowl of Grandma’s Potato Soup, the ultimate homemade comfort food that tastes just like it came from her kitchen. This creamy, hearty soup is packed with wholesome ingredients—tender Russet potatoes, sweet carrots, crisp celery, and aromatic hints of garlic and thyme—perfectly balanced in a buttery, velvety broth. Lightly mashed potatoes create a luxuriously thick texture, while optional toppings like cheddar cheese, crispy bacon, and fresh parsley add a customizable, indulgent finish. Ready in under an hour, this easy potato soup recipe is the perfect family-friendly meal for chilly nights, offering simple yet irresistible flavors that warm the soul.
Scan with your phone to download!
Peel and dice the potatoes into 1-inch cubes. Set them aside in a bowl of cold water to prevent browning.
Dice the onion, carrots, and celery into small, even pieces. Mince the garlic cloves finely.
In a large stockpot or Dutch oven, melt the butter over medium heat. Add the diced onion, carrots, and celery, and sauté for 5-7 minutes, or until softened.
Add the minced garlic to the pot and cook for 1 minute, stirring frequently, until fragrant.
Sprinkle the flour over the vegetable mixture and stir to combine. Cook for 2 minutes to eliminate the raw flour taste.
Slowly pour in the chicken or vegetable broth, whisking constantly to prevent lumps. Bring the mixture to a simmer.
Drain the potatoes and add them to the pot. Stir in the salt, ground black pepper, and dried thyme. Cover the pot and simmer for 15-20 minutes, or until the potatoes are fork-tender.
Using a potato masher, lightly mash some of the potatoes in the pot to thicken the soup. Leave some chunks for texture.
Stir in the whole milk and let the soup simmer for an additional 5 minutes. Taste and adjust seasoning as needed.
Serve the soup hot, garnished with optional toppings such as shredded cheddar cheese, chopped fresh parsley, and crumbled bacon. Enjoy!
Serving size | (3997.2g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 3094.6 |
Total Fat 113.2g | 0% |
Saturated Fat 61.0g | 0% |
Polyunsaturated Fat 1.7g | |
Cholesterol 337.3mg | 0% |
Sodium 10191.1mg | 0% |
Total Carbohydrate 406.1g | 0% |
Dietary Fiber 34.2g | 0% |
Total Sugars 56.9g | |
Protein 122.6g | 0% |
Vitamin D 245.4IU | 0% |
Calcium 1816.3mg | 0% |
Iron 21.6mg | 0% |
Potassium 10563.9mg | 0% |
Source of Calories